> The software setting was already "all".
> I had some real speak voices installed rs-jill and rs-tom and vcm_samantha
> etc. I uninstalled those and retried installing talks. This time the
> installation succeeded. I am not sure if this is a known issue or just some
> wierd behaviour on my phone.

> Are you jsure your date and time are set correctly?  I ask because when I
> went to update mine I had a similar problem then I tried again with no
> success.  Finally I checked the date (as I do not use that facility) and it
> was 1 February 2011 and the release was 17 February 2011.  I changed the
> date and it worked for me.
